The Martin D-41 is a trusted icon in Martins acoustic lineup, blending powerful tone with refined elegance. Each guitar includes a hardshell case. The satin genuine mahogany neck, featuring a Golden Era GE Modified Low Oval profile, high-performance taper, and 25.4 scale length , ensures smooth play ability. Luxurious abalone details, including the rosette, top-edge trim, and hexagon inlays, elevate its timeless design.
Steak spruce GE top bracing, as featured on the Modern Deluxe Series, delivers vintage-inspired tone and sustain, while updates like a re imagined neck profile, thinner fingerboard, refined bridge heel improve play ability aesthetics. Handcrafted with a solid spruce top and East Indian rosewood back sides, the D-41 offers resonant voice that's balanced across all playing styles. Its Dreadnought body size delivers a bold, projectile sound with strong bass, clear trebles, and rich overtones, making it ideal for players who want their music to fill the room. Complete with antique white binding, a bound ebony fingerboard, an bridge bone pins, gold open gear tuners, and variety of striking gloss options, the D-41 is guitar you can trust to unleash artist within.
